New York City Has Two Million Rats and One New Rat Czar

Kathleen CorradiHer anti-rat loyalty began in elementary school, when she organized a petition asking her Long Island town to do something about the vandalism behind her home. Now, she has been crowned the mouse tsar of New York City.
The 34-year-old beat out 900 other applicants for a position that, according to the job posting, required “a brash attitude, a cunning sense of humour, and a generally unruly temperament”. mayor Eric Adamswho announced it last week, has voiced his hatred of rodents believed to number around two million in New York.
